In the world of YouTube and YouTubers, there are some you hear about constantly and others not as much. Below there are six of my personal favorite YouTubers that I feel deserve a massive shout out. These are the 6 top YouTubers that need to be on your radar!
If you are looking for a YouTuber who is positive, a bit of a hippie with an awesome taste in music, then Meghan Hughes is your girl. One of the things I personally love about her is her ability to spread good energy. She’s a person who can lift your spirits and inspire you to create. Meghan is very smart and wise; you’d probably won’t believe she’s only twenty. Her taste in music is very eclectic, she’s the girl you’d also hit up for new music choices. Meghan is an incredibly cool lady, more than worth your time.
If there is one person’s closet I’d want raid its Jenn Im’s. Her sense of fashion is something to be marveled at. She knows how to dress up everything from plain white T’s to the clothes you wear to bed; and her shoe collection is a dream. When I watch her videos often enough I feel inspired to get up do something whether it crating content for my own channel or just taking pen to paper. Jenn also gives great fashion advise and makeup tips.
If there is one word to describe Stephanie Villa or Soothing Sista if you will, it would have to be dope af (Technically that’s more that’s more than one but…). My first impression of Stephanie was “Wow, she’s so freaking cool!” And it doesn’t hurt that her sense of fashion consists of vintage T shirts, combat boots, and beautiful pieces of jewelry, adding on to her cool factor. She is a positive role model, who is totally accepting and welcoming to all types of people. FUN FACT: Jenn and Stephanie are best buds in real life.
You know that person you are good friends with inside your head? For me that person would be Remi Ashten. She is positive, funny and a true DIY champion. She is extremely giving and cares a lot about the people around her and especially her dog, Daisy. Remi is the friend that everyone should have in their life. She also has a vlog channel, RemLife, where you can see all the adventures and good times she has with her equally as cool friends.
It was one random day, deep in YouTube, when I stumbled across Jordan Hanz’s channel. I knew I had to subscribe when I saw her call coffee, “God’s Nectar”, curse and transform herself into a beautiful mermaid/ octopus hybrid. She is so talented and most of her work looks realistic and well executed. Jordan also has this 31 days of Hanz-o-ween she does that is totally epic. She is MUST to check out and believe me you will be amazed at what she can do.
Cake, cake, and more cake. In my personal option, Yolanda is the queen of cakes. The cakes she creates are massive and often look like the real thing. Yolanda is a super talented cake artist, she and her crew are funny and always coming up new ideas for different cakes to make. The time and effort she puts into making her cakes shows and is well worth the watch. But warning, watching her videos might make you hungry or in my case crave a slice of cake.
